Transaction 87ed265362a43a8825b5e97af94fb32a2e922dc5f17ba4fa38657c2146696768
1 Input
1 Output
-
87ed265362a43a8825b5e97af94fb32a2e922dc5f17ba4fa38657c2146696768:0
- value
- 306380
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df57967798fa9ff30b4ab477e845913bb6d7b41
- address
- bc1qlh6hjeme375l7v954drhapzezwak676phxdcnu